#e190e4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e190e4 is composed of 88.2% red, 56.5% green and 89.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 1.3% cyan, 36.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 297.9 degrees, a saturation of 60.9% and a lightness of 72.9%. #e190e4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c321c9.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#e190e4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f040f is the darkest color, while #fffe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#e190e4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bfb5bf is the less saturated color, while #fa75ff is the most saturated one.
